Examples from Java Examples in a Nutshell

My book, Java Examples in a Nutshell contains 127 useful example programs. You can download them from the O'Reilly & Associates web site. Note, however that the examples will only be really useful if you buy the book.

Commercial Use

The examples are free for non-commercial use. If you want to use them commercially, however, you must purchase a license for them. This page explains how to do that.

No Warranty

Before purchasing a commercial-use license, you must understand that the programs in Java Examples in a Nutshell were written as examples, and were never intended as production-quality software.  They have not been carefully tested, nor used in a production environment.  If you find the programs useful nevertheless, and want to use them in your software, please understand that they come with absolutely NO WARRANTY of any kind.  Neither David Flanagan nor O'Reilly & Associates are responsible for any loss or damages of any kind resulting from the use of these programs.

Price

A commercial-use license costs US$50 for each programmer who will be using them.  You may also purchase a site-license for any number of programmers within an organization for US$500.   You may pay electronically by credit-card, or by check.

Electronic Payment

To purchase a license or site license online, click  on one of the links below.  The links take you to the "DigiBuy" Web site, which supports secure credit-card transactions.  Follow the instructions at the DigiBuy site to complete the purchase.   After the purchase, you will be taken to a confirmation Web page, and  will receive  e-mail from DigiBuy confirming your purchase.  You can print out the web page or the e-mail for use as a receipt.  Additionally, within several days of your purchase, you will also receive e-mail from me, confirming that you are now a license holder.

Buy an individual license or licenses

Buy a site license

Payment by Check

You may also purchase a license or site license by sending a check for the appropriate amount to:
David Flanagan
P.O. Box 4032
Bellingham, WA 98227-4032
U.S.A.

The check should be payable to "David Flanagan" and should be in US funds and drawn on a US bank.
Please include an e-mail address to which a confirmation and receipt should be sent.